Sulfur Resistant Perovskite Electrocatalysts for High Temperature Applications

Abstract

Owing to increasing demand for catalytic operations in clean and carbon negative energy systems, development of catalysts and electrocatalysts has been gaining importance and interest has been growing in mixed oxides (perovskites) that are known for their chemical and thermal stability. In the present work, some perovskite catalysts/electrocatalysts, mostly with structures ABO3 and AxA’(1-x)ByB’(1-y)O3 containing Co, Cr, La, Mo, Sr and V have been developed and studied in terms of electrical conductivity at increasing temperatures up to 1100 K. Among the samples,La0.9Sr0.1Cr0.5V0.5O3, LaSr0.5V0.5O3 ve La0.9Sr0.1Cr0.75Co0.25O3 had relatively higher conductivity.
